The Hogue Rubber Grip Finger Grooves Beretta 92/96 Made a Bold First Impression
The Beretta 92/96 series is a legendary firearm, known for its reliability and service history. However, the factory grips can sometimes feel a little slick, especially with sweaty hands or in adverse weather conditions. This led me on a quest for a grip upgrade, and the Hogue Rubber Grip Finger Grooves Beretta 92/96 immediately caught my eye.
I’ve always been a fan of Hogue’s reputation for quality rubber grips. They provide a tactile, secure hold that inspires confidence. I was looking for something that would enhance my control over my Beretta 92FS without significantly altering its profile or adding excessive bulk.
Upon receiving the grip, I was immediately impressed by the feel of the rubber. It was soft and pliable, yet felt durable and grippy. The finger grooves looked well-defined and appeared to be ergonomically designed to fit the hand comfortably. Compared to the stock plastic grips, the Hogue grip felt like a significant upgrade in terms of material and texture.
I considered other options, including aftermarket grips made from G10 and aluminum. Ultimately, I chose the Hogue Rubber Grip Finger Grooves Beretta 92/96 for its balance of comfort, control, and affordability. My initial impression was overwhelmingly positive; the grip promised to enhance both the feel and performance of my Beretta 92FS.
Real-World Testing: Putting Hogue Rubber Grip Finger Grooves Beretta 92/96 to the Test
First Use Experience
My first range session with the Hogue Rubber Grip Finger Grooves Beretta 92/96 installed was enlightening. I spent the afternoon at my local outdoor range, putting around 200 rounds of 9mm through my Beretta. The weather was typical for a summer day: hot and humid.
The Hogue grip immediately proved its worth in the sweaty conditions. The rubber provided a secure and confident hold, preventing the gun from slipping in my hand. The finger grooves, while seemingly a small detail, made a world of difference in terms of control and indexing. The improved grip allowed me to maintain a consistent shooting posture and deliver accurate shots.
There was no period of adjustment needed, the grips felt natural from the moment I picked it up. The improvement in grip compared to the factory grips was immediate and significant.
Extended Use & Reliability
After several months of regular use, the Hogue Rubber Grip Finger Grooves Beretta 92/96 continues to impress. I’ve used it in various conditions, from sunny days at the range to damp mornings during tactical training exercises. The grip has held up remarkably well.
There are no signs of cracking or degradation of the rubber, despite being exposed to various solvents and cleaning agents. Cleaning is easy; a quick wipe down with a damp cloth is usually sufficient. Compared to the factory grips, the Hogue grip provides a superior level of comfort, control, and durability. This is an upgrade that continues to pay dividends every time I use my Beretta.

Who Should Buy Hogue Rubber Grip Finger Grooves Beretta 92/96?
The Hogue Rubber Grip Finger Grooves Beretta 92/96 is perfect for Beretta 92/96 owners looking to improve their grip and control. This includes target shooters, law enforcement personnel, and anyone who uses their Beretta for self-defense. People with larger hands will likely find that it provides a better, more ergonomic fit.
Individuals with very small hands or those who prefer a smooth, minimalist grip might want to consider other options. Must-have modifications are not needed, this is a solid upgrade on its own.
